Our flagship wine bar is hidden in the original crypts – designed by the legendary Sir Christopher Wren – beneath St. Bride’s Church. Legend has it that the eye-catching steeple of St. Bride’s inspired the first ever tiered wedding cake (the name is also fitting, though only a coincidence). Fleet Street is right in the heart of the city, a true London affair: a stone’s throw from the Thames, in the shadow of St.Paul’s cathedral and well served by transport links. At the bottom of St. Bride’s Passage, we get the best of both worlds – part of the pulse and hubbub of London, but quiet and peaceful, sheltered by the church and churchyard above. We are a humble business, born from the desire to make good wine unstuffy and inclusive. Since 2009 we’ve been seeking out handcrafted wines from relatively unknown vineyards around the world. We directly import our wines, avoiding extra margins for agents and distributors. And because they’re made with loving care, most of our wines, intentionally or otherwise are biodynamic, organic or sustainably produced.
